What Is Vegetable Glycerin and How It Works
Our Vegetable glycerin is a plant-based humectant made from coconut oil through hydrolysis. It deeply hydrates skin and hair, enhances softness, and improves elasticity. Widely used in vegan skincare and natural beauty, vegetable glycerin helps retain moisture, soothe dryness, and promote a smooth, healthy glow.

How to Use Glycerin for Hair
Dilute with Water:
1. Mix 1 part Glycerin with 2-3 parts water or Ayumi Rose water to avoid stickiness and dryness.
Optional Additions:
Add a few drops of essential oils (e.g., Lavender or Rosemary) for fragrance and added benefits.
Application:
2. Spray or apply the mixture evenly to damp hair, focusing on dry or frizzy areas.
Massage:
3. Gently massage into the scalp to lock in moisture and improve hydration.
Leave or Rinse:
4. For leave-in hydration, use sparingly.
Alternatively, leave on for 20-30 minutes as a hair mask and rinse thoroughly.
Frequency:
Use once a week for best results.
Glycerin helps retain moisture, reduces frizz, and adds shine to hair. Avoid use in very dry climates, as it may draw moisture from your hair.
How to Use Glycerin for Body
Dilution:
1. Mix glycerin with water, rose water, or a carrier oil (e.g., coconut or almond oil) in a 1:3 ratio to prevent stickiness.
Application:
2. Apply the mixture to clean, damp skin after bathing to lock in moisture.
Focus on dry areas like elbows, knees, and heels.
Massage:
Gently massage the Glycerin into your skin until fully absorbed.
For Dry Skin:
Combine Glycerin with a few drops of your favorite essential oil for added hydration and soothing effects.
Frequency:
Use daily for best results, especially during dry weather.

What is Vegetable Glycerin?
Vegetable glycerin is a clear, odourless, and slightly sweet liquid derived from plant oils such as coconut, soy, or palm. It’s a natural humectant that attracts moisture, making it a popular ingredient in skincare, haircare, and body care for deep hydration and softness.
